General Function

This role supports the Company’s mission to create a community with a primary focus on promoting and guaranteeing premium and professional eyecare experiences with every patient at their local practice. The role also supports advancing the profession of optometry in the healthcare industry. This position is the leader within the local practice and marketplace and establishes the practice as the premier destination for all vision needs within the community.

Major Duties and Responsibilities

  • Works closely with managing and associate doctors to ensure the highest standard of patient care and workflow efficiency.
  • Conveys a patient-centric approach through leading team performance, coaching, inspiring, and developing team members to deliver unsurpassed patient experiences, every time.
  • Recruits and selects high caliber, success-oriented talent and creates a talent pipeline for succession.
  • Maintains inventory accuracy through proper inventory management procedures.
  • Drives change management activities in the practice to include adoption of new technology, processes, and continued improvement.
  • Ensures all Company approved safety programs are implemented and maintained.
  • Follows workforce management guidelines to optimally staff all practice hours of operation.
  • Monitors all aspects of practice operations, provides on-the-job training and support to team members in accordance with Company policy and procedure.
  • Analyzes practice financial data and makes recommendations regarding next steps to optimize overall practice profitability.
  • Controls profits and expenses for the store, through operational functions, sales and medical/vision insurance claim accuracy, labor, supply ordering, etc.
  • Demonstrates deep understanding of eyecare business and patient care and has the capability to transfer knowledge to superior patient experiences and business results.

  • Works weekends and evenings in support of the business needs (varies by location).

Basic Qualifications

  • High School graduate or equivalent
  • 4+ years management/supervisory experience, preferably in an eyecare/healthcare setting
  • A proven track record of delivering results and growth
  • Excellent business and financial acumen including operational analysis
  • Familiarity with technology, such as point-of-sale, patient record systems, and other software applications
  • Strong communicator and listener

PREFERRED QUALIFICATIONS

  • College degree or equivalent
  • ABO Certification
